Jamaica is a tropical Caribbean getaway where clear blue waters meet sandy beaches and palm trees sway in the breeze. Budget-conscious travellers will find a small but excellent selection of hotels that offer comfort and island charm without high prices. From clifftop rooms with ocean views to beachside cottages set in lush gardens, these properties serve up cosy accommodations, refreshing pools, and tasty local food. Whether you’re after a quiet retreat or a simple base for exploring, these affordable Jamaican hotels make it easy to enjoy the island’s natural beauty and laid-back vibe without stretching your budget.

Chic boutique shorefront hotel. Rooms feature an eclectic mix of mosaic headboards, antiques and stained glass windows. Cottages with kitchenettes. Outdoor pool, lovely gardens and access to beach. Excellent seafood cuisine and laid back bar. A very cool stay for families or couples.

  • Beach Life - Very cool atmposhere, especially considering the Pelican bar, Jamaica’s coolest bar a boatride away
  • Families - Full of family friendly fun, from art and cooking classes to river safari; larger suites are perfect
  • Restaurant - Two restaurants serving locally sourced food with an emphasis on the catch of the day
  • Fishing - Catch snapper, jackfish, kingfish, tuna or grouper and ask the chef to cook them

Popular hillside property with a happening bar, restaurant and nearby beach club. Quirky rooms and terraces decorated with rattan furniture, local artwork and reclaimed wood boast impressive ocean views, as does the large infinity pool. Rustic cool; the place to stay for party-lovers on a budget.

  • Beach Life - It's 10 min walk to the nearest beach. There's a shuttle to the property's beach club on Calabash Beach with bar and restaurant
  • Value chic - Great value for money; it's hard to believe a sea-facing property with atmosphere and facilities can be this affordable
  • Restaurant - Laid-back all-day Tree-top Bar & Restaurant serves classic holiday food; think jerk chicken, salads, sandwiches and burgers
  • Sights nearby - On cloudy days take a day trip into Kingston to visit the Bob Marley museum
